## Partner SFTP Drop — Marlowe Freight

Files land nightly between 02:00–03:30 UTC in the inbound drop. Watcher job `marlowe-ingest` picks them up; if nothing arrives by 04:00, the Quillhook alert fires. Do NOT re-request files from Marlowe before checking the quarantine folder — malformed headers get parked there silently. Retries are safe; ingest is idempotent on file checksum. Rotation of the drop credentials is quarterly, owned by platform. Full escalation steps and contacts are on the runbook page.

dashboard of taduf-tahof = https://confluence.tolvaqlabs.internal/browse/browse/display/f01240ca

## Changelog — Font vendoring defaults changed

As of this release, the Bracken UI build no longer fetches third-party fonts at build time. All typefaces used by the Lanternwell suite are now vendored into the repo under a dedicated assets directory, and the fetch step is skipped by default. If you're onboarding, nothing to install — the fonts travel with the checkout. The build flags controlling this behavior are listed below.

settings of hadup-yafog:
LAMAEL_PIN=3761
LAMAEL_TENANT=istmir
LAMAEL_METRICS_HOST=metrics.lamael.plorvasys.test
LAMAEL_SEAL=seal_8ea68500
LAMAEL_STANDBY_TEAM=fraok

**Firmware Update Channel Sessions — Support Guide**

When a Lumawarm thermostat enrolls in the `beta-ring` channel, the Parloq update service opens a signed session that persists across reboots. If a customer reports a stuck update, verify the session state in the Channel Console before re-enrolling the device. To query a device's session directly from the diagnostic API, use the token below.

portal login ticket: eyJhbGciOiJIUzI1NiIsInR5cCI6IkpXVCJ9.eyJzdWIiOiIwEOsktwVNwIn0.-UJU3fdyyCgG

# Client setup for the Ledgerloom partition manager.
# Ledgerloom stores transaction rows in tables partitioned by
# calendar month; this client calls the internal partition API to
# pre-create next month's partition and archive anything older
# than eighteen months. Note for review: the client only needs
# DDL rights on the transactions schema, nothing broader, and
# all calls are logged to the Loomtrail audit topic. It
# authenticates to the partition API with the internal key below.

service key, yadug-bajog: zpat3_pou